Transaction f95badc126014e3cae1feca164489b615dd3cc75b77f21bdcfb16ca10f06ae90

1 Input
2 Outputs
  • f95badc126014e3cae1feca164489b615dd3cc75b77f21bdcfb16ca10f06ae90:0
  • value  6774504
    address  3KY38UsDnDozoLrESQGjjrqSqW333WhWBB
  • f95badc126014e3cae1feca164489b615dd3cc75b77f21bdcfb16ca10f06ae90:1
  • value  27041704
    address  16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y